The Maya thought the world was divided into three parts the Heavens, the Earth, and the Underworld, which were linked together by a giant World Tree. A piece of the heaven was reserved for the Maya afterlife. They believed their ancestors lived in this … family beach trip checklistWeb18 feb. 2024 · There are at least 200 gods in the Maya pantheon. Important ones include gods of death, fertility, rain and thunderstorms, and creation.
